Body & structure
Reports naming the vehicle structure, frame, body panels, doors, hood and trim.
From owner reports, verbatim
MY PANORAMIC ROOF EXPLODED WHILE DRIVING PULLING OUT OF MY DRIVEWAY. SOUNDED LIKE SHOTGUN WENT OFF IN MY CAR. GLASS BLEW OUTWARD AND REMAINING GLASS PUSHED OUT POINTED TOWARDS SKY.

Tires & wheels
Reports naming tires, wheels, hubs, or the tire-pressure monitoring system.
From owner reports, verbatim
MY COMPLAINT IS THAT THE RUN FLAT THAT COMES WITH THE VEHICLE IS SO UNSTABLE THAT ANY FLIGHT BUMP ON THE ROAD RESULTS IN A BURSTED TIRE. EVEN DRIVING ON THE INTERSTATE HIGHWAY IS NO EXCEPTION. I HAVE HAD TO CHANGE THE TIRES DO OFTEN THAT I AM NOW VERY RELUCTANT TO DRIVE THE CAR. I HAVE EVEN CONTACTED BMW CUSTOMER SERVICE TO COMPLAIN BUT TO NO AVAIL. I BELIEVE THIS PARTICULAR MODEL HAS A MISMATCH OF THE TIRE WIDTH AND SPECIFICATIONS. PLEASE INVESTIGATE AS THIS IS A VERY SERIOUS ROAD SAFETY ISSUE.
